The Cypriot final takes place next Saturday at 21.15 (CET+1) at the studios of RIK 3 in Nicosia. The show will be broadcast by RIK 1, RIK Sat and there will also be live streaming on both the broadcaster's site as well as eurovision.tv

Last year the CyBC server crashed during the presentation show of Comme ci, comme ca by Evridiki creating problems for international fans who wished to watch it live. This year though there will also be live streaming on Eurovision.tv as well as the CyBC website, so it is expected that anyone wishing to watch the final will be able to do so without problems.

The Cypriot final takes place on Saturday 12 January at 21.15 (CET+1). Ten artists will be competing for the ticket to Belgrade:

1. This can't be love – Sofia Strati
2. Turning to you – Miria Pampori & Alex Manison
3. Sugar Mountain – Elizabeth Anastasiou
4. Moments of madness – Elena Skarpari
5. Rejection – Marlain Aggelidou
6. Femme fatale – Evdokia Kadi
7. I can't be – Nikolas Metaxas
8. Butterfly – Nikolas Metaxas
9. Rescue me – Mirto Meletiou
10. Calling You – Konstantinos Andronikou
